Analysis of HIIT

Overall verdict

  • HIIT is a solid, effective training approach that delivers strong fitness results in a short amount of time, making it a good choice for most people looking to improve cardiovascular health and burn calories efficiently.

Why this product is good

  • Time-efficient workouts that deliver results in as little as 15-30 minutes
  • Boosts cardiovascular fitness and metabolic rate effectively
  • Continues burning calories after the workout via the afterburn effect (EPOC)
  • Requires little to no equipment and can be done anywhere
  • Highly adaptable to different fitness levels and goals

Recommended for

  • Busy individuals with limited time to exercise
  • People looking to improve cardiovascular fitness quickly
  • Those aiming for fat loss and improved metabolism
  • Intermediate to advanced exercisers seeking a challenge
  • Anyone wanting varied, engaging workouts without a gym
